Free Plan: Way Better Than It Should Be
I was honestly shocked at how much MailerLite gives away for free. Their no-cost plan supports up to 1,000 subscribers and lets you send 12,000 emails monthly — that’s actually enough to run a real marketing campaign, not just test the waters.
You get access to their drag-and-drop builder (which is surprisingly intuitive), AI-powered subject line generators, and basic automation for simple stuff like welcome emails.
The free plan includes one user seat, a decent selection of templates (nothing mind-blowing, but functional), and basic reporting to track your campaigns. You can create signup forms, landing pages, and even do some basic audience segmentation. It’s not just a glorified trial — you can run meaningful campaigns without spending a dime.
Where it falls short:
- Stuck with just one user account
- No A/B testing at all
- Only basic automation (forget complex workflows)
- Limited segmentation capabilities
- Email support isn’t included (you’re on your own)
While the free plan is generous, you’ll hit walls pretty quick if your team grows or your campaigns get more sophisticated. It’s perfect for solo operators or super small teams, but you’ll eventually want more.
Growing Business Plan: Serious Bang for Nine Bucks
At just $9/month, the Growing Business Plan delivers ridiculously good value. It removes the email sending cap entirely, lets up to 3 people access the account, and unlocks more advanced automation, promotional pop-ups, and AI tools for every campaign.
You get unlimited audience management and full access to their template library, making it perfect for online stores, content creators, or consultants running regular campaigns.
The 24/7 email support is a massive upgrade — I had a question at 11pm and got a response within an hour. That kind of reliability matters when you’re sending time-sensitive campaigns. The workflows are significantly more powerful than the free version, and those pop-up forms actually convert pretty well for lead capture.
The downsides:
- A/B testing only works on subject lines, not content
- No click heatmaps or deep content performance tracking
- Multivariate testing isn’t available
- No live chat support when you need instant help
- Custom reporting is off the table
The Growing Business Plan hits a great balance between power and price, but you might outgrow it if you need sophisticated testing, detailed reporting, or immediate support. For most small teams though, it delivers everything essential without unnecessary extras.
Advanced Plan: Where Things Get Serious
Starting at $19/month, the Advanced Plan is where MailerLite really flexes. You get everything from the Growing Business tier plus Facebook integration (which works surprisingly well), dynamic content blocks for personalization, click maps to see exactly where people engage, and much more sophisticated automation workflows.
The unlimited user seats are perfect for marketing teams or agencies that need collaboration features. The segmentation gets much more granular, you get 24/7 live chat support (which I’ve found responds within minutes), and you can test both subject lines AND content to optimize performance.
Email delivery is noticeably faster, and you can request a dedicated IP if deliverability is crucial for your business.
What’s missing:
- No multivariate testing for power users
- Lacks AI-based segmentation and predictive insights
- Custom reporting isn’t included
- No dedicated account manager for strategy help
- SMS marketing costs extra
While the Advanced Plan is comprehensive, it’s not quite enterprise-level. If you need predictive analytics or truly personalized support, you’ll need to step up to Enterprise. But honestly, for most mid-sized businesses, this tier hits the perfect balance of features and affordability.

Understanding the Pay-As-You-Go Option
If you’re not into monthly commitments, MailerLite’s credit system is worth considering. It’s perfect for marketers who send campaigns sporadically or want tight control over costs. The math is simple: 1 credit = 1 email to 1 subscriber. These credits work for regular campaigns, automated sequences, and RSS emails.
The best part? Credits never expire — which is a lifesaver for seasonal businesses or consultants with clients who send irregularly. Despite not having a recurring plan, you still get access to core features like the drag-and-drop editor, basic automation, signup forms, and reporting tools.
Just know that some of the premium perks like 24/7 support, advanced automation, and AI tools only come with the subscription plans. This pay-as-you-go approach works best for businesses with sporadic sending patterns, event-based campaigns, or agencies juggling multiple smaller lists.

Understanding MailerLite’s Transactional Email System
In MailerLite’s world, a “block” means 25,000 transactional emails – those system-triggered messages like order confirmations, password resets, and shipping notifications that absolutely need to arrive quickly and reliably.
The pricing follows a volume-based model – the more blocks you buy, the cheaper each one gets. Starting at $30 per block, prices can drop to as low as $20 per block for high-volume senders. This tiered approach helps businesses scale their transactional communication more efficiently as they grow.
If deliverability is critical (and let’s face it, for transactional emails it usually is), you can get a dedicated IP for around $50/month. This is particularly valuable for brands sending large volumes or handling sensitive information.
One thing to note – transactional email is only available as an add-on for Advanced and Enterprise plan users. Free and Growing Business tiers can’t access this feature. Also worth mentioning: unused email blocks don’t roll over to the next month, so you’ll want to monitor your sending volumes carefully to avoid overpaying.

Additional SMS Info Worth Knowing
- How Credits Work: Each standard text message (under 160 characters) costs 1 credit. The actual price varies depending on which country you’re sending to and how it’s delivered.
- MMS Support: Currently, MailerLite doesn’t support MMS messaging at all – everything is text-only, so forget about sending images or videos.
- Unused Credits: SMS credits typically don’t roll over to the next month unless your specific billing agreement says otherwise (worth checking with their support team).
- Plan Eligibility: SMS marketing is only available if you’re on a paid plan – specifically Advanced or Enterprise. Free and Growing Business users are out of luck here.
- Country Coverage: While SMS features work in over 80 countries, the pricing, compliance requirements, and sender ID rules vary dramatically. Some countries require you to pre-register or verify your sender ID before you can send a single message.
- Compliance Rules: You absolutely must comply with local telecom regulations. Countries like India and the UK have strict rules requiring pre-registration of sender IDs and explicit opt-in consent from recipients. Breaking these rules can get your account suspended real quick.
